Challenging First Day Hike (Registration Required)
Join us in welcoming 2026 with this challenging, Ranger-guided hike in the newest state park in Texas!
This moderate to challenging, 3.5-mile hike guides visitors down our Lakeshore Accessible Trail, across the spillway and dam, weave up hill on Cross Timbers Trail, and meander down Ben’s Trail with stunning views of our rolling hills, Palo Pinto Creek, and unique rock formations along the way. This route has varying degrees of difficulty including a rocky crossing at the spillway making it not recommended for strollers.
